Diagnosis of endometrial polyp by hysteroscopy

2006 
Objective:To analyze the diagnosis value of hysteroscopy in endometrial polyp(EP),comparing with diagnostic curettage and ultrasonography diagnosis.Methods:Analyzing 845 hysteroscopy patients of abnormal metrorrhagia from Sep,2002 to Nov,2004,in which 94 patients were diagnosed as EP.For all the cases,ultrasonography had been done before hysteroscopy,diagnostic curettage had been done to all the EP patients,all the patients received endometrium electrosection through hysteroscope,and pathological examination after operation.Then the coincidence between the positive ratio of ultrasonography diagnosis,hysteroscopy,diagnostic curettage and pathological examination in EP's diagnosis were compared.Results:85 patients were diagnosed as EP by the pathological examination,the coincidence ratio of hysteroscopy and pathological examination in diagnosing EP is 90.43%,positive ratio of hysteroscopy diagnosis in EP is 11.12%,false positive ratio is 1.18%.The coincidence ratio of ultrasonography and pathological examination in diagnosing EP is 25.88%,positive ratio is 3.79%,false positive ratio is 1.32%.The coincidence ratio of diagnostic curettage and pathological examination in diagnosing EP is 0,positive ratio is 0.Conclusion:Hysteroscopy diagnosis is accurate and intuitionistic than diagnostic curettage and ultrasonography in EP diagnosis.
